23227 ZIP Code — Richmond, VA

Henrico County, Virginia

ZIP code 23227 is located in Richmond, Virginia, within Henrico County. It covers approximately 11.48 square miles and serves a population of 25,758 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one, served by area code 804.

About ZIP code 23227

The housing stock consists of a significant share of large multi-unit buildings. Most homes were built in the 1970s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$306,900. Owner-occupancy sits near the national average at 53%.

The gap between median ($63,114) and mean household income suggests income inequality — a small number of higher earners pull the average up. 39%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 21 minutes is near the national average.

Educational attainment is near the national average, with 45%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.
